What specifically makes a beauty product 'vegan' in Canada?
In Canada, a beauty product is considered 'vegan' if it contains absolutely no animal-derived ingredients or by-products. This includes common components like beeswax, honey, carmine, lanolin, collagen, and gelatin. It's a commitment to using only plant-based or synthetic alternatives, ensuring no animals are exploited in the ingredient sourcing.
Are all cruelty-free products also vegan?
No, not necessarily. 'Cruelty-free' means the product and its ingredients were not tested on animals. However, a cruelty-free product can still contain animal-derived ingredients (e.g., beeswax, honey). For a product to be both, it needs to explicitly state both 'vegan' and 'cruelty-free' or carry specific third-party certifications for each claim.
How can I easily identify certified vegan beauty products in Canada?
Look for recognized third-party certification logos on product packaging. The Vegan Society's sunflower logo and PETA's 'Vegan' bunny logo are common indicators for vegan status. For cruelty-free assurance, the Leaping Bunny logo is the gold standard. Many Canadian brands are transparent about their certifications on their websites.

Are there any health risks associated with vegan beauty products?
Generally, vegan beauty products are considered very safe, often formulated with natural, gentle ingredients. However, like any beauty product, individual sensitivities to specific plant extracts or essential oils can occur. Always check the ingredient list if you have known allergies and perform a patch test when trying new products, regardless of whether they are vegan or not.
